当你打开一个可靠的VPN服务,却发现Facebook仍然无法加载,甚至显示“连接失败”或“无法访问此网站”,这种现象在很多用户中并不罕见,作为网络工程师,我经常遇到这类问题,它往往不是单纯的“VPN没开”那么简单,而是涉及多个技术环节的协同故障,本文将从原理到实践,为你系统梳理可能的原因及解决方案。
明确一点:VPN的作用是加密并路由你的网络流量,绕过本地ISP或区域限制,理论上,只要VPN连接成功,你就能访问被封锁的内容(如Facebook),但现实情况复杂得多,以下是常见原因和对应排查步骤:
-
确认VPN连接状态
很多人误以为“VPN图标亮了”就等于连通,建议使用工具如ping 8.8.8.8或访问 https://www.whatismyip.com 检查IP是否变更,如果IP未变化,说明VPN未真正生效,需检查是否配置错误、证书过期或服务器宕机。 -
DNS污染或劫持
即使VPN连接正常,若客户端DNS未正确指向VPN服务器提供的DNS(如OpenDNS或Cloudflare),仍可能被本地ISP拦截,解决方案:在VPN设置中启用“DNS over TLS/HTTPS”选项,或手动修改设备DNS为1.1.1(Cloudflare)或8.8.8(Google)。 -
防火墙或杀毒软件拦截
Windows Defender、第三方杀毒软件(如卡巴斯基)可能误判VPN流量为恶意行为,阻止其通过,临时关闭防火墙测试,若恢复正常,则需将VPN客户端加入白名单。 -
Facebook自身封禁策略
某些国家/地区会动态检测并封禁高频使用的VPN IP段,Facebook可能会对来自中国、俄罗斯等地的大量请求进行限速或直接屏蔽,此时可尝试更换VPN节点(如切换至美国、欧洲服务器)或使用支持“混淆模式”(Obfuscation)的高级协议(如Shadowsocks + obfs)。 -
MTU设置不当导致分片丢包
部分老旧路由器或运营商会因MTU值过高(默认1500)导致UDP/TCP分片失败,可在Windows命令提示符执行:ping -f -l 1472 8.8.8.8
若返回“需要拆分数据包”,说明MTU过大,需将路由器MTU设为1400-1450。
-
浏览器缓存或代理冲突
有些浏览器(如Chrome)会缓存旧IP地址或误用系统代理,清除缓存后重启浏览器,或在设置中关闭“使用代理服务器”选项。
如果你已经尝试上述所有步骤仍无效,请记录以下信息:
- 当前使用的VPN品牌与协议(如WireGuard、OpenVPN)
- 手机/电脑操作系统版本
- 网络环境(家庭宽带/校园网/移动热点)
这些细节能帮助专业团队进一步定位问题,网络问题往往是“多层叠加”的结果——就像拼图,缺一块就无法完成,别急着换VPN,先冷静分析,一步步排查,你会发现,解决问题的过程比答案本身更值得学习。

半仙加速器-海外加速器 | VPN加速器 | VPN翻墙加速器 | VPN梯子 | VPN外网加速






